For patients with hypotension, if it is only mild and the patient does not have any discomfort, treatment may not be needed and it is usually sufficient to increase the amount of salt in the course of diet. If the patient has low blood pressure, there may also be symptoms such as transient darkness and dizziness. It is advisable to increase nutrition and eat tonic products that are good for regulating blood pressure, such as ginseng, astragalus, and raw pulse drink. In addition, to strengthen physical exercise, you can do aerobic exercise, such as brisk walking, jogging, etc., which is good for regulating the body’s blood pressure. In addition, for the elderly, due to the aging of the elderly body, so when changing from a lying position to a seat or standing position, the movement should be slower to prevent postural hypotension resulting in a fall.
